Difference Between ICD-9 and ICD-10
ICD stands for International Classification of Diseases. It’s a global coding system used to track diseases, health conditions, and procedures.
Over the years, ICD has been updated to reflect advances in medicine and technology.
Two important versions in the U.S. healthcare system are:
ICD-9 (used until 2015)
ICD-10 (currently in use)
Let’s explore how they differ and why ICD-10 matters today.
๐ What Is ICD?
Developed by the World Health Organization (WHO).
Used by hospitals, clinics, and insurance companies.
Helps track patient diagnoses and procedures.
Standardizes health data across the world.
๐ ICD-9 Overview
Full name: ICD-9-CM (Clinical Modification)
Introduced in the 1970s
Used in the U.S. until October 1, 2015
Has 13,000+ diagnosis codes and 3,000+ procedure codes
Example ICD-9 Code:
250.00 — Diabetes mellitus without mention of complication
๐ ICD-10 Overview
Full name: ICD-10-CM (diagnosis) and ICD-10-PCS (procedures)
Adopted in the U.S. in 2015
Developed to support more specific, detailed, and modern medical data
Has 68,000+ diagnosis codes and 87,000+ procedure codes
Example ICD-10 Code:
E11.9 — Type 2 diabetes mellitus without complications
๐ Key Differences Between ICD-9 and ICD-10
| Feature | ICD-9-CM | ICD-10-CM / PCS |
|---|---|---|
| Year Introduced | 1970s | 2015 (U.S.) |
| Diagnosis Codes | ~13,000 | ~68,000 |
| Procedure Codes | ~3,000 | ~87,000 |
| Code Structure | Mostly numeric | Alphanumeric |
| Characters per Code | 3–5 digits | 3–7 characters |
| Specificity | Limited | High (more detailed) |
| Laterality Support | No | Yes (left/right side) |
| Modern Medical Terms | Lacking | Up-to-date |
| Flexibility for New Codes | Low | High |
๐ก Code Structure Example
ICD-9
Numeric or mix (e.g., 401.9)
3–5 characters max
Less descriptive
ICD-10
Alphanumeric (e.g., S72.001A)
Up to 7 characters
Breaks into:
Category
Etiology
Location
Severity
Encounter Type

๐ Example Comparison
| Condition | ICD-9 Code | ICD-10 Code |
|---|---|---|
| Asthma, unspecified | 493.90 | J45.909 |
| Type 2 Diabetes, no complication | 250.00 | E11.9 |
| Open fracture of femur | 821.01 | S72.001A |
| Encounter for flu vaccine | V04.81 | Z23 |
Notice:
ICD-10 gives more context like body part, side (left/right), type of visit (initial/follow-up).
๐ฅ ICD-10-PCS (Procedures)
Used mainly in inpatient hospital settings.
ICD-9 Procedure Code:
81.54 — Total knee replacement
ICD-10-PCS Code:
0SRC0JZ — Replacement of right knee joint with synthetic substitute, open approach
More specific and structured!

๐ง Challenges in Transition
Switching from ICD-9 to ICD-10 was not easy.
Issues Faced:
Retraining coders and staff
Updating software systems
Resubmitting claims
Cost and time for healthcare providers
But the benefits have been worth it over time.
๐ Conversion Tools
To help transition:
Crosswalks or GEMs (General Equivalence Mappings) were created
Help map ICD-9 codes to ICD-10
Not 1-to-1: one ICD-9 code may map to many ICD-10 codes
๐ฎ Future: ICD-11
ICD-11 is the latest version by WHO
Released globally in 2022
Yet to be widely adopted in the U.S.
Even more digital, detailed, and flexible
